Kitchen Area Taps: Repair Service and Upkeep

Fixing and maintenance is less complicated than ever before and also can be done by a handy homeowner. Rubber rings can be quickly replaced at home when needed. Prior to dealing with the sink, switch off the water and also cover the drains pipes. Effectively cleansing and maintaining your tap will prolong the life as well as maintain it in good working order.

Check the maker's instructions for cleansing the surface. Most can be cleaned with mild soap and also water or window cleaner. Do not utilize rough cleaning items, which can damage the coating. Polish matte completed with a furnishings polishes. Inspect the tag to ensure the product you utilize is risk-free for the material of your fixtures.

Installment Treatments.



The brand-new taps are less complicated to mount than older designs. The majority of producers include all links and fittings needed to install the device on your own. Complete installation instructions are included with the tap. Look for total sets that include the versatile hoses needed to attach to your water supply. If these aren't included, you will certainly require to acquire them individually. Do not be upset if you see bits in the water when you complete setup. This is just fragments trapped in the fixture from manufacturing and installment. They will rinse clear if you allow the water run for a few minutes.

How to Install or Replace Your Kitchen Faucet: A Step-by-Step Guide


Tools and Materials Needed


Of course, the most important thing you need before starting any kitchen faucet installation is the new faucet. You can pick out a kitchen faucet online or in any home improvement store. The entire process will be easier if you choose one with the same number and same-size holes as your old model, but it's not technically necessary.



Next, take a look at your new faucet and your existing sink to see if you have the proper materials for hooking everything up. Some faucets have already-attached tubing on the faucet end already while others will just hook up to standard tubing lines. If you can choose your tubing, most experts recommend braided steel supply lines, which are sturdy and flexible, and have leak-proof connectors already attached. Most sinks just need tubes measuring 12 inches in length and three-eighths of an inch to a half-inch in diameter. Check your faucet and sink to make sure standard sizes will work.


In addition to basic materials, be sure you have these tools:


  • An adjustable wrench


  • A pipe wrench


  • A standard screwdriver set


  • A bucket


  • Old rags or towels


  • Caulk (optional)


  • Teflon tape (optional)


  • A flashlight (optional but it makes things a lot easier)


  • A basin wrench (may not be needed)


  • A hammer (may not be needed)


  • A pipe and tube cutter (may not be needed)


  • A handsaw (may not be needed)



  • Pay Attention


    The most important tip for installing a kitchen faucet is simply to pay attention as you work. This type of installation doesn’t require any special skills or technical knowledge. However, there are a lot of small parts that must be assembled in the correct order to prevent leaks or other mishaps. Before you start, read over all the installation instructions that came with your faucet. If you're new to working with faucets, watch some online instructional videos from a source you trust.


    Prepare for Tight Squeezes


    Once you get started, you’ll quickly find that the tricky part is just being able to reach into tight places and turn various nuts and bolts. If possible, invest in a basin wrench to make this job easier.


    Cut It Out


    Another tip for saving on time is cutting out your old faucet. If you aren't planning on using your leaky faucet again, you can just cut through assembly parts to pop it right off your sink.


    Get the Picture?


    If you’re worried about being able to reattach everything properly, consider taking a photo before you start. This can help you remember the original plumbing configuration.


    Mind the Gaps


    To prevent leaks, use caulk under the faucet plate and Teflon tape around the supply-line connectors.
